Cyclic oxidation behavior of Pd-Ni-Al coating

摘要Palladium-modified aluminide coatings were prepared by low-pressure pack cementation on the nickel-base superalloy IN738, and their cyclic oxidation behavior was investigated by TGA, XRD, and SEM at 1 050degreesC. Results show that the Pd-Ni-Al coatings have more adhesion than the simple aluminide coatings, and that the microstructural degradation of the Pd-Ni-Al coating is slower than that of the simple aluminide coating. The palladium plays a significant role in alumina stabilization and in delaying the degradation of beta-phase. Key words: Pd-Ni-Al coating; aluminide coating; cyclic oxidation; palladium
